/// Method that creates a Path used to define the shape of a Sweep feature. A Path is a contiguous
|
|
/// set of curves that can be a combination of sketch curves and model edges.
|
|
/// curve : A SketchCurve or an ObjectCollection containing multiple sketch entities and/or BRepEdge objects. If a single sketch curve
|
|
/// or edge is input the isChain argument is checked to determine if connected curves (they do not need to be tangent)
|
|
/// should be automatically found. If multiple curves are provided the isChain argument is always
|
|
/// treated as false so you must provide all of the curves in the object collection that you want included in the path.
|
|
/// The provided curves must all connect together in a single path.
|
|
/// The input curves can be from multiple sketches and bodies and they need to geometrically connect for
|
|
/// a valid path to be created.
|
|
/// isChain : Optional argument, that defaults to true. If this argument is set to true, all curves and edges that are end point
|
|
/// connected to the single input curve will be found and used to create the path.
|
|
/// This argument is only used when the first argument is a single SketchCurve/BRepEdge object.
|
|
/// Returns the newly created Path.
|
|
core::Ptr<Path> createPath(const core::Ptr<core::Base>& curve, bool isChain = true);
